Early Childhood Centre Director Carnarvon, a career move that comes with a lifestyle change too. If weekends spent exploring the coast, camping, fishing, swimming and discovering some of Western Australia's most beautiful landscapes sound like your kind of life, Carnarvon could be your next adventure.
Located on WA's Coral Coast, Carnarvon gives you a great base to explore this incredible part of the state. Spend your time off road-tripping to Coral Bay and Ningaloo Reef, heading south towards Shark Bay, or discovering the beaches, national parks and coastline closer to home. And with four weeks annual leave plus an additional two weeks special leave, you'll actually have the time to enjoy it.
Benefits On Offer
- Above award salary
- Permanent full-time position
- Four weeks annual leave plus two weeks special leave
- Relocation assistance up to $3,000*
- Housing allowance
- Laundry allowance
- Free access to our Employee Assistance Program
- Career development and advancement opportunities within a national not-for-profit
- Online inductions and one-on-one development sessions to support you from day one
What You'll Do
- Lead, support and mentor a team of educators
- Manage the day-to-day operations of the service
- Build strong partnerships with children, families, staff and the local community
- Manage rosters and ensure regulatory ratio requirements are met
- Drive continuous improvement and service compliance
- Support staff development, recruitment and performance
- Manage service budgets and funding
- Oversee Workplace Health & Safety requirements
- Deliver curriculum in accordance with One Tree's philosophy as the service's Educational Leader
- Act as Responsible Person, First Aid Officer and Nominated Supervisor of the service
